Problem
Existing image forming apparatuses lack the ability to accurately ascertain the adjustment state of pressure contact force in the pressure contact portion, leading to issues such as paper jams and poor image quality when different paper types are used.
Innovation Solution
The apparatus includes a toner image former, a fixer with adjustable pressure contact force, and controllers that notify users to confirm paper type and adjust the pressure contact force accordingly, restricting selection buttons until conditions are met.

An image forming apparatus includes: a toner image former that forms a toner image on paper based on image information; a fixer that includes at least a pair of rollers and fixes the toner image formed on the paper at a pressure contact portion formed by the pair of rollers; an adjuster that adjusts a pressure contact force in the pressure contact portion according to a paper type; and one or more controllers that control execution of a job related to image formation via the fixer. The one or more controllers provide, to a user, a notification prompting the user to confirm the paper type of the paper being fed in a case where the paper type set for the execution of the job differs from the paper type of the fed paper.
